Licensing and Player Protection

Regulation provides the foundation for judging whether a casino deserves attention. A legitimate operator should clearly identify its licensing authority, company details, and responsible gambling resources. If those facts are hidden behind vague language, treat the situation with caution rather than optimism.

  • Check the stated licence number and regulator.
  • Look for secure website connections and transparent privacy policies.
  • Confirm that age restrictions and identity checks are explained.
  • Review deposit limits, cooling-off tools, and self-exclusion options.
  • Find customer support channels before money changes hands.

Verification can feel like paperwork at the airport, yet it serves a purpose. Operators commonly request identity documents to meet anti-money-laundering requirements. A sensible casino explains what may be requested, how documents are handled, and when withdrawals are normally reviewed.

Games, Software, and Fairness

Game variety matters, but catalogue size alone proves very little. A wall of titles can be as useful as a supermarket aisle stocked entirely with different flavours of the same biscuit. More meaningful questions concern software providers, rules, return-to-player information, and whether outcomes are generated by tested random-number technology.

Area to inspect Why it matters Warning sign
Software provider Shows who developed and maintains the game Titles with no identifiable source
RTP information Explains the theoretical long-term return No accessible game rules
Table limits Helps match play with a planned budget Limits revealed only after registration
Game loading and stability Reduces interruptions and disputed rounds Frequent crashes or unclear results

Slots are built around variance, meaning short sessions can produce results far removed from long-term statistical expectations. A high RTP does not promise a win on Tuesday evening, and a cold streak does not mean a machine is “due.” The reels are not keeping a diary of your previous losses, despite what casino folklore may suggest.

Deposits, Withdrawals, and Fees

Payment information deserves the same attention as the game lobby. Reliable platforms normally list supported methods, minimum and maximum amounts, processing stages, and possible charges. Bank cards, e-wallets, and alternative payment services may each follow different verification and withdrawal procedures.

Withdrawal timing is especially important. A displayed processing estimate may refer only to the casino’s internal approval stage, while the payment provider adds another delay. Read whether pending withdrawals can be cancelled, whether winnings must return through the original method, and whether currency conversion costs apply.

Questions Worth Answering Before Funding an Account

  • Is the minimum deposit compatible with your planned spending limit?
  • Are deposits and withdrawals processed through the same method?
  • Does the operator charge an administrative or currency fee?
  • What documents can trigger a verification review?
  • Is there a maximum withdrawal limit, and where is it disclosed?

Anyone promising effortless cash-outs deserves a raised eyebrow. Even reputable operators can pause a payment for compliance checks, but silence is another matter. Clear communication is the difference between a routine review and a digital maze with no exit sign.

Promotions Without the Confetti

Promotional offers should be assessed as contracts, not decorations. The headline amount is only one detail; wagering requirements, eligible games, contribution percentages, expiry periods, maximum bet rules, and withdrawal restrictions can materially change the value.

Promotion term What to check
Wagering requirement Whether it applies to the bonus, deposit, or both
Game contribution Which titles count fully or partially
Maximum bet The permitted stake while completing terms
Expiry The deadline for meeting the conditions
Cash-out limits Whether bonus-linked winnings are capped

A promotion can look generous until the arithmetic arrives wearing a stern expression. For example, a bonus tied to a 40-times wagering requirement may require substantial total stakes before any withdrawal is permitted. Calculate the obligation first, then decide whether the offer suits your budget and patience.

Responsible Play and Practical Judgement

Entertainment should remain the purpose, not a disguise for financial rescue plans. Set a spending limit before playing, use time reminders, and avoid increasing stakes to recover losses. Chasing is rarely a strategy; it is usually frustration wearing sunglasses.

Good casino research is ultimately quiet and methodical. Compare terms, test support with a simple question, inspect the licence, and start only with an amount you can comfortably lose. If the site makes basic information difficult to find, walking away is not timid—it is sound bankroll management.
